Why Live in Bluffton Park

Bluffton Park is a vibrant neighborhood characterized by its Charleston-inspired homes with vinyl siding, mature trees, and a strong sense of community. Residents enjoy outdoor activities, often gathering at the community pool or walking their dogs around the four small lakes. The neighborhood's proximity to Old Town Bluffton, just a mile away, allows easy access to a variety of dining options and shops, including the popular Squat N' Gobble and Captain Woody's Seafood Bar. The area features contemporary colonial, cottage, and Lowcountry-style homes built in the early 21st century, with many homes showcasing double-decker porches and manicured lawns. Bluffton Park is part of the Beaufort County School District, which is highly rated, with schools like Red Cedar Elementary and Bluffton High School receiving commendable ratings. Oscar Frazier Park, within walking distance, offers baseball and soccer fields, a playground, and a walking trail. While Bluffton Park is susceptible to hurricanes and tornadoes, residents have shown resilience, often coming together during such events. For daily conveniences, Food Lion and Target are about 2 miles away, and the Savannah Hilton Head International Airport is approximately 30 miles from the neighborhood.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Bluffton Park a good place to live?
Bluffton Park is a good place to live. Bluffton Park is considered somewhat walkable and somewhat bikeable. Bluffton Park has 9 parks for recreational activities.It is somewhat dense in population with 8.0 people per acre and a median age of 36. The average household income is $81,705 which is below the national average. College graduates make up 37.7% of residents. A majority of residents in Bluffton Park are home owners, with 23% of residents renting and 77% of residents owning their home. Is Bluffton Park, SC a safe neighborhood?
Bluffton Park, SC is safer than the average neighborhood in the United States. It received a crime score of 3 out of 10.
How much do you need to make to afford a house in Bluffton Park?
The median home price in Bluffton Park is $527,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$105,400 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.66%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$2,710 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$116K a year to afford the median home price in Bluffton Park. Learn how much home you can afford with our Home Affordability Calculator. The average household income in Bluffton Park is $82K.
